If your power supply to your house is so bad that you need a generator to run your reprap then maybe running it off a car battery might be an idea.

Leave the charger perminantly connected and also grab a 500watt inverter to run your PC off (well, it will charge a laptop, printing from an SD card would allow for a headless printer).

You would need an automotive fuse box (blade fuses) too, for safety.

depending on where you are you might have a few options available. like a larger UPS. a couple of car batteries with a good sized inverter.

it comes down to how long you need it to run and how much money.

car batteries or marine are a good start, but be carful, they can give off hydrogen gas (if i remember right.)
